How does eating late at night affect your health?

Makarem and her colleagues thought that this meal timing may play a role in the rise in rates of obesity, high blood pressure and diabetes seen in recent years. So, they set out to see if that's the case. Though the study looked at just one specific population in the U.

Indeed, several studies conducted abroad have shown that meal timing may be associated with developing risk factors for heart disease , she added. In the study, the team looked at data from two separate days in which participants reported their eating habits, and compared this information with measurements such as blood pressure and blood sugar. They found that over half of the people in the study consumed 30 percent or more of their daily calories after 6 p.

Those participants had higher levels of fasting blood sugar a measure of the amount of sugar in the blood when someone hasn't eaten in hours , higher levels of insulin the hormone that regulates the amount of sugar in the blood , higher levels of HOMA-IR a marker of resistance to insulin and higher blood pressure than participants who reported eating less than 30 percent of their daily calories after 6 p. Much of the research in this area seem to suggest that the health benefits of limiting or reducing nighttime eating is independent of how much people eat throughout the day.

However, it may be too soon to tell if the types of foods people eat at night make a difference. Is the reduction in cancer risk related to whether the people who avoided eating late were a healthier weight?

Many of the studies that suggest a benefit to limiting nighttime eating have attempted to control for the weight or body mass index an index of weight in relation to height of participants. Therefore, the beneficial effects do not seem to be dependent on whether someone is at a healthy weight. Are the findings from these studies reason enough for people to alter their nightly routines? Altering the time of meals is a relatively simple change that many people can understand and adopt if they so choose.
